Abstract

The utility model discloses an intelligent medicine bottle cap, which comprises a bottle cap body, wherein the bottle cap body comprises a detection switch, a battery, a PCB module, a silica gel ring, a movable cover plate and a thread module; the fixing part is arranged on the bottle cap body and used for mounting the bottle cap body on a medicine bottle body for containing a target medicine; and the communication part is arranged on the bottle cap body and used for monitoring the taking condition of the target medicine contained in the medicine bottle and sending prompt information according to a monitoring result. The utility model can solve the problem of independent medication management of each medicine, and avoid that a plurality of medicines are placed in the same container, medication reminding is disordered and the setting process is complicated. The intelligent medicine bottle cap disclosed by the utility model can be used for independently managing and reminding each medicine by utilizing the characteristic that one medicine is independently used, and the reminding reliability and effectiveness are greatly improved.

Background
Patients want to recover early and generally need to take the medicine according to the dosage on time. In fact, it is difficult for many patients to ensure that the dosage is taken on a timely basis. Statistically, in the united states, about half of the patients, especially the elderly, are unable to take their medication in time and this results in a large amount of additional medical expenditure each year, or even life-threatening events.
Currently, intelligent medicine bottles for reminding patients to take medicines on time have appeared in the market. Referring to FIG. 1, the Glowcaps CONNECT developed by Vitality, Inc. of the United states was a previous generation of vial devices for administration of medications. The scheme of route + medicine bottle is used, a communication network based on a local wireless network is arranged in the medicine bottle, the uncovering of the medicine bottle is determined through the triggering of a switch, and the medicine bottle is connected with the Internet through a GPRS communication system arranged in the route. The disadvantages are that: the system is complex, so the price is expensive and the system cannot bear the price in China. GPRS networks have high power consumption, large delays, and poor network coverage, which can cause a number of after-market problems. GPRS gradually quits the network in the global scope, and the service life and the service condition of the equipment cannot be estimated. The bottle cap battery adopts a button battery, so that the reminding volume is small, the battery is frequently replaced, and the extra cost is high.
In use, a user needs to pour medicine into such intelligent medicine bottles. The medicine bottle product is reminded to use medicine in the foreign market, and the system design is complicated, and the cost is expensive. A large number of medicine taking reminding products in the market transmit data by GPRS, Bluetooth, WiFi or LoRa communication at present. The existing products for medication management in the domestic market are in the form of small medicine boxes and medicine boxes, and the medication management product loss that each medicine independently reminds time and the number of medicines can be really achieved. In view of the above problems, no effective solution has been proposed.

Example 1
Referring to fig. 2, the present invention provides an intelligent medicine bottle cap, which is characterized in that: a bottle cap body; the fixing part is arranged on the bottle cap body and used for mounting the bottle cap body on a medicine bottle body for containing a target medicine; the communication component is arranged on the bottle cap body and used for monitoring the taking condition of the target medicine contained in the original medicine bottle and sending prompt information according to a monitoring result; the bottle cap body comprises a detection switch, a battery, a PCB module, a silica gel ring, a movable cover plate and a thread module. The thread module comprises various threads, various sizes and materials and is used for adapting to medicine bottles with different styles, calibers, threads and materials.
Optionally, when the bottle cap is screwed on the body of the medicine bottle, the detection switch is pressed down by the movable cover plate to close the switch, and when the PCB module detects that the switch is closed, it is determined that the bottle cap is screwed, and the medicine bottle is in a closed state;
otherwise, the movable cover plate is bounced, the switch is disconnected with the movable cover plate, and the PCB module detects that the switch is disconnected, and then the bottle cover is judged to be opened, namely, the user takes medicine.
Optionally, the intelligent bottle cap further comprises: the storage component is arranged on the bottle cap body and used for storing and sending the preset time of the prompt message and at least one of the following information of the target medicine contained in the original medicine bottle: name, dose, time of administration; the prompting device comprises a sound and light alarm device and is used for reminding a user to take medicines according to set time and reminding the user not to take medicines repeatedly; the intelligent bottle cap is externally provided with a unique number and a two-dimensional code.
Optionally, the battery is a built-in lithium battery.
Optionally, the intelligent bottle cap is triggered and detected by a physical detection switch; detecting the alarm sound at a distance of 1cm, wherein the maximum sound intensity is more than or equal to 60 db;
optionally, the intelligent bottle cap can obviously observe the color change of the light alarm device under direct sunlight; the medicine bottle is vertically placed, and when the bottle cap is upward, the light alarm device can be seen from all angles above the horizontal plane of the bottle cap.
Optionally, be provided with on the bottle lid body of intelligence bottle lid: the medicine outlet and the medicine outlet cover, wherein when the medicine outlet cover is opened, the target medicine is poured out from the original medicine bottle through the medicine outlet; when the medicine outlet cover is buckled, the target medicine is packaged in the original medicine bottle. Further, when the medicine outlet cover is opened, a power switch of the communication part is closed; when the medicine outlet cover is buckled, the power switch of the trigger communication part is disconnected. Further, when the medicine outlet cover is opened and the power switch of the communication component is closed, the number of the target medicines poured out of the medicine outlet and/or the time for pouring out the target medicines are recorded, and corresponding prompt information is sent.
Optionally, the tightening torque of the intelligent bottle cap is more than or equal to 5 NM. Under the premise of 100g of the medicine bottle, the medicine bottle can freely fall from a height of 1m to a smooth and hard ground at any angle, and the main body of the bottle cap is not structurally damaged.

Example 2
According to the embodiment of the utility model, the embodiment of the device for the intelligent bottle cap is provided.
Fig. 3 is a schematic structural diagram of a monitoring system for medicine taking according to an embodiment of the present invention, and as shown in fig. 3, the monitoring system for medicine taking of an intelligent bottle cap is characterized by comprising: any one of the intelligent bottle caps, the public internet of things cloud platform, the database, the data server and the application server in embodiment 1; the application server comprises an app and a management platform of the user terminal.
The intelligent bottle cap medicine bottle is connected with the public Internet of things cloud platform through a communication network; the data server at the background is in butt joint with the public Internet of things cloud platform, and receives data or sends instructions; the background data server is connected with the database and operates the database; the application server obtains data from the data server and provides application services for the APP and the management platform of the user terminal, wherein the application services comprise a small program interface and background Web services. During the use, can pass through the fixed part with intelligent bottle lid and install on corresponding former medicine bottle, replace original medicine bottle lid. If the medicine is poured out from the medicine bottle, the communication component detects and records the information such as the number of the poured medicine and the time for pouring the medicine, and generates corresponding prompt information according to the information, for example, whether the patient takes the medicine according to time and/or quantity, and the communication component can further transmit the generated prompt information to a device such as a user terminal which is matched in advance. In this way, the user can browse the received prompt information and remind the patient, wherein the user can be the patient himself or a guardian of the patient, and the like. The communication network is in the form of NB-IoT network or Bluetooth or ZigBee or Lora.
Optionally, the public internet of things cloud platform is connected with the telecommunication wing cloud platform.
According to the embodiment, the independently designed intelligent bottle cap is matched with the original medicine bottle for containing the target medicine, and the bottle cap is arranged on the original medicine bottle for containing the target medicine by the fixing part through the fixing part; the communication part for the monitoring holds the condition of taking of the target medicine in former dress medicine bottle, and send tip information according to the monitoring result, reached and only used intelligent bottle lid can remind the patient to use medicine according to the volume on time, thereby realized avoiding the same medicine bottle of used repeatedly to hold different medicines and the serious technological effect of medicine pollution that leads to, and then solved in the correlation technique because the same medicine bottle of used repeatedly holds different medicines, lead to medicine cross contamination's technical problem easily.
Furthermore, all the intelligent hardware sends data to the cloud server through the mobile network, the data are analyzed and stored by a back-end service program deployed on the cloud server, and when the front-end application programs (the web management end and the ape health applet) need to display the data (for example, medicine taking records are displayed), the cloud server returns the data to the front-end application program. When the front-end application program issues instructions to the intelligent hardware, the instructions are firstly stored on the cloud server, and when the intelligent hardware communicates with the cloud server next time, the cloud server returns the instructions to the intelligent hardware.
The working process of the intelligent bottle cap is as follows: when the patient opens the medicine outlet cover, the wireless communication part is triggered to start and prompt information is sent to the terminal equipment of the user, and at the moment, the patient can be reminded according to the prompt information received by the terminal equipment, such as on-time medicine taking, on-time medicine taking according to the amount, or medicine taking amount/time adjustment and the like; when the medicine outlet cover is not opened by the patient, the wireless communication part cannot be triggered to send prompt information to the terminal equipment of the user, and at the moment, the terminal equipment cannot receive the corresponding prompt information.
